This alert indicates the circuit breaker guarding the Tollgate upstream API has opened, meaning repeated failures exceeded the configured threshold and Marlinflow is now serving cached responses. The breaker will attempt a half-open probe every 90 seconds; manual intervention is only needed if it stays open longer than 15 minutes. Before forcing a reset, confirm Tollgate's status with their on-call. The full recovery procedure is documented on the internal page below.

operations page: https://jenkins.zemvarcloud.local/job/merge_requests/repo/build/73930b4b30f0a8ed

Key Ceremony Checklist — Item 7 (Smashcatch pipeline)

After the new signing key for the Smashcatch crash-report pipeline is sealed, verify ingest resumes and symbolication completes on the canary build. If the sealer stalls, abort and re-run from item 5. Unsealing during rollback requires two witnesses present. Enter the recovery passphrase shown below when prompted.

unlock words, yawig-kagef: gordor-holvan-ulaael-pramir-ulaiel-tamdor

MANAGEMENT MEETING MINUTES

Attendees: dept heads plus Priya (chair). Main item: Q3 cash-flow forecast for Larchway Goods. Receivables are running a touch slow, mostly the Bexton account, but payables timing gives us cover. Agreed to hold capex requests until the mid-quarter refresh. Tomas will circulate the revised model Monday. One sensitive point was noted for heads only, below.

board note of taduf-bawig: The board signed off on a budget of $35.0 million for Project Silok. The renewal with Istmirek Holdings closes at $22.0 million a year, 31 percent below the last contract.

## Runbook: Snapshot Tests for Glimmerkit Plugins

Hey plugin folks — before publishing, run the snapshot suite against the reference renderer so your components don't drift between Glimmerkit versions. Stale snapshots are the top cause of rejected submissions, so regenerate them after any style change. Point your .env at the hosted comparison service, keep SNAPSHOT_STRICT=true, and add your comparison-service token on the line below.

vault entry, hagug-fahag: COURIER_KEY3=30e